The baby name Borka is a unisex name, 2 syllables long and is pronounced "Bor-ka".
Borka is Slavic in Origin.
Borka is a Slavic name that means "little battle" or "little warrior". It is a diminutive form of the name Borislav, which was a popular name among Slavic tribes in the Middle Ages. The name Borka is commonly used in Serbia, Croatia, and other Slavic countries. It is a unisex name, meaning it can be given to both boys and girls.
The pronunciation of Borka is BOR-ka. The name is composed of two parts: "bor" meaning "battle" or "warrior" and the diminutive suffix "-ka" which means "little". The name has a strong and powerful meaning, reflecting the bravery and courage of a warrior. The origin of the name Borka can be traced back to the Slavic tribes that inhabited Eastern Europe in the Middle Ages. The name Borislav was a popular name among these tribes, and Borka is a diminutive form of that name. The name has been used for both boys and girls in Slavic countries for centuries. Today, it is still a popular name in Serbia, Croatia, and other Slavic countries, and is gaining popularity in other parts of the world as well.
